Unpredictability in games is not about random chaos; it is a carefully tuned mechanism that invites players to project hypotheses, test strategies, and revise beliefs about how to win. When designers seed strategic ambiguity into encounters, quests, or loot systems, players experience a frontier that rewards curiosity with fresh patterns, even after many hours. The skillful blend of known rules and unforeseen twists creates a cognitive itch: can you predict the next turn, the next item drop, or the rival move? This tension keeps anticipation high, but it must be bounded by coherent logic so players feel their efforts map to real outcomes rather than arbitrary luck.
The psychology of suspense in games rests on three pillars: novelty, agency, and consequence. Novelty keeps the sensory and narrative feed engaging; agency grants players meaningful choices; consequence ensures actions translate into lasting shifts in the game world. When these elements align, a player learns to anticipate not just outcomes, but the possibility space itself. Predictability is not eliminated; it evolves. Players become adept at recognizing probabilistic cues, gauging risk, and recalibrating strategies in light of new data. The result is a virtuous cycle where curiosity remains tethered to skill development, reducing fatigue and increasing willingness to invest time.
Unpredictability shapes skill growth by aligning risk with learnable feedback.
In enduring games, unpredictable moments are not mere shocks; they function as opportunities for players to expand their repertoires. Encounter design can introduce evolving enemy patterns, shifting weather, or adaptive economies that respond to players’ choices. When players notice that the game’s rules flex in response to their behavior, they perceive a living system rather than a static puzzle. This realization prompts experimentation: trying different loadouts, revisiting early decisions with new information, or exploring alternate routes. The cognitive payoff comes from building mental models that incorporate both stable mechanics and occasional surprises, thereby sustaining curiosity through complex, layered experiences.

The social dimension of unpredictability amplifies its pull. Cooperative play and competitive matchmaking create dynamic feedback loops where outcomes depend on the unpredictable but learnable actions of others. Players adapt by refining communication, timing, and collaboration strategies. Communities that celebrate experimentation—sharing micro-tactics, failure analyses, and new meta strategies—convert uncertainty into a shared adventure. As players observe others’ innovative approaches, they feel compelled to test their own limits, expanding the frontier of what is possible within the game’s frame. In healthy ecosystems, uncertainty becomes social glue that binds players together across time.
The emotional texture of unpredictability sustains immersion and resilience.
A core benefit of well-tuned unpredictability is accelerated learning through exposure to near-miss scenarios. When a plan nearly succeeds but fails due to an unforeseen variable, players experience a potent form of feedback. They adjust increments in judgment, timing, resource management, and risk assessment. The most effective designs allow these near-misses to accumulate into a resilient set of habits: pattern recognition that anticipates counterplay, flexible pacing to handle shifting threats, and a habit of testing multiple hypotheses under pressure. Over time, the player’s internal model becomes robust enough to navigate complexity with confidence, which in turn sustains interest in continuing to refine technique.

Yet unpredictability must be filtered through clear signals so players remain autonomous players rather than passive observers. If randomness feels random, motivation declines and frustration rises. Designers achieve balance by embedding transparent probabilistic rules, explainable consequences, and consistent feedback loops. Players should feel they can influence outcomes through skillful action, even when luck plays a part. The thrill emerges from navigating variance with control, not from surrendering to capricious forces. When players trust the system’s logic, their curiosity remains active, because they believe their growth is earned and visible, even as surprises appear.
Designers cultivate curiosity by balancing novelty with mastery.
Emotional engagement deepens when unpredictability intersects with meaning. Players need stakes—personal investments tied to progress, identity, or narrative direction. Surprises that shift these stakes can reframe a goal, renewing purpose and driving persistence. For example, a sudden twist in the story can redefine a character’s arc or a reward’s value, prompting players to reassess their long-term plans. When surprises feel consequential rather than arbitrary, players develop an attachment to the game’s evolving world. This attachment translates into longer play sessions, more experimentation, and a willingness to endure temporary setbacks for the prospect of meaningful payoff.
The cadence of unpredictable events should align with pacing principles to avoid fatigue. Strategic pauses, reflective moments, and opportunities for players to consolidate learning are essential between bursts of surprise. If the game erupts with back-to-back shocks, it can overwhelm even highly engaged players. Conversely, sparse, well-timed jolts can feel ceremonial and memorable. Successful designs rely on rhythm: a predictable core loop layered with occasional deviations that nudge players toward new strategies. The aim is a sustainable tempo where curiosity is consistently fed, allowing players to anticipate, savor, and learn from the next disruption.

The practical takeaway is to design with curiosity as a measurable target.
Mastery-invoking unpredictability rewards players who invest in long-term exploration. When players feel they are approaching a frontier—whether it’s a hidden ability, a rare combination, or a secret area—their commitment deepens. The key is to present mysteries that are solvable with increased expertise, not hidden behind impenetrable randomization. This approach invites deliberate practice: testing, failing, retrying with adjustments, and gradually unlocking the underlying rules. As skills mature, players perceive new layers of complexity and nuance, which motivates continued play. The sense of progression becomes entwined with surprise, creating a compelling trajectory that sustains engagement beyond initial novelty.
Communities that share personal breakthroughs contribute to a culture of curiosity. When players discuss their successful strategies, near misses, and unexpected outcomes, they create a reservoir of tacit knowledge accessible to others. This communal knowledge accelerates individual learning curves and sustains collective enthusiasm. Moderators and designers can nurture this environment by encouraging transparent failure analysis, highlighting creative play, and recognizing experimentation. A vibrant culture of inquiry transforms unpredictable moments from isolated events into meaningful units of shared experience, sustaining motivation as new players join and veterans reassess their goals.
From a practical standpoint, predicting which moments will spark curiosity involves mapping the player journey. Designers should identify friction points where players hesitate, ambiguous mechanics worth clarifying, and opportunities for meaningful risk-reward exploration. By sequencing these moments through progression milestones, they ensure novelty remains accessible without overwhelming players. Feedback systems must translate surprise into learning signals—clear indicators of what the player achieved, what remains uncertain, and how future choices alter the world. The goal is to keep curiosity self-reinforcing: curiosity leads to action, action yields feedback, and feedback fuels deeper inquiry.
For players, cultivating a resilient curious mindset means embracing uncertainty as a skill to be managed. Treat each unexpected turn as a chance to test an assumption, refine a strategy, or broaden a repertoire. Track your own patterns: when do you seek information, when do you revert to familiar tactics, and when do you bravely try something new? By staying observant, reflective, and adaptive, players convert unpredictability into sustained interest rather than brief spectacle. In the end, long-term curiosity is less about never knowing and more about learning how the game evolves with you, and how your evolving play shapes that evolution in turn.
